After a successful theatrical release, the most violent Indian flick ‘Marco’ has started streaming on OTT. Now the Telugu version of the movie is gearing up for OTT release.
The OTT platform Aha shared the Telugu OTT version update of ‘Marco’ via their Twitter handle with a note that read, “Get ready to experience the most violent and biggest film on Aha! #Marco storms in with action like never before. Streaming from Feb 21 only in Telugu, on Aha! Overseas streaming from Feb 18 !.”
Meanwhile, the makers had shared the deleted scene from the movie on the last day, featuring Riyaz Khan as a police officer. The deleted scene which showed a fight sequence at a police station where ‘Marco’ is taking it out on a group of police officers and prisoners who harassed his girlfriend, received mostly criticism from netizens. Majority of the audiences said that it was the apt decision to delete the sequence from the movie as it did not match with the story narrative flow.
‘Marco plot
Blind yet perceptive, Victor identifies his friend Wasim’s killer, Russell, by recognizing the distinct scent of his perfume and car. To silence him, Russell teams up with Wasim’s own brother, Tariq, and brutally murders Victor by dissolving him in acid.
Heartbroken, Victor’s brother Peter grieves the loss, while their fiercely protective adopted sibling, Marco, vows revenge. As Marco begins his hunt, Russell’s powerful father, Tony, orchestrates a deadly ambush on Peter. Though gravely injured, Peter survives just long enough to reveal the truth to Marco.
Fueled by rage, Marco takes down Russell’s men one by one, dismantling their operations. Sensing the threat, Tony retaliates by kidnapping Victor’s pregnant wife, Isha, using her as bait to lure Marco into a final showdown.
In a brutal climax, Marco battles against overwhelming odds, taking down Tony, Tariq, and their empire, ensuring justice for Victor and those he loved.
